Every bride should feel free to use any type of flower and color scheme that she loves and wishes to see in the wedding. You don’t have to settle for less by choosing roses because they are considered the most suitable perfect flowers for a wedding.

You can choose your own favorite types of flowers, no matter how unpopular are they in weddings or a more unusual and perhaps unconventional type of flower that are used today in modern vanguradist weddings. We recommend you to consult his list with summer wedding flowers that are considered the most stylish, chic and voguish ones for contemporary brides to use: gardenias, ranunculus, irises, lilies of the valley, lavenders, peonies, tulips, sweet peas, freesias, amaryllis, lisinathus, stephanotises, hydrangeas, amarnathus, sunflowers, carnations, orchids, pansies, wildflowers, chamomiles, narcissuses, gladiolas, gerbera daises, anemones, hyacinths, chrysanthemums or spider mums, asters, zinnias, dahlias, yarrows, lilacs, violets, Billy Balls or agaphnatus.

As you can see, the list is quite long and egenrous with lots of preferences and tastes, so we think that you will be able to find something that you like or a nice creative combination that you can use. When it comes to colors, the choices are even more diverse and the possibilities of mixing two or three types of colors in order to obtain a more vibrant and seductive eye-catchy look are numberless.

But to help you some more or give you a few directions and examples of colors that are used in today fashionable weddings, here is a list of colors that you can study and pick whatever feels or sounds ok to you: aubergine, scarlet red or tomato red, emerald green, lime green or sage green, buttercup yellow or bright yellow, vintage mate orange or vibrant bright orange, peach and coral, pale pink, blush, magenta, fuchsia, baby pink, hot pink, navy blue, pale or baby blue, sapphire blue or turquoise, teal, cream, beige, chocolate brown, mocha, ivory, pearl gray, burgundy, silver, gold or bronze.


Your aestival wedding flower centerpieces can be enriched, beautified or emphasized with all kinds of sparkling accessories – especially if you’re going on a beach wedding or with more exotic herbals and branches or fruits that can provide the wedding atmosphere with a more inviting, warm, sensual and unique vibe.
